MultiBeam Sonar Option
The Imagenex Delta-T profiling sonar option is fully integrated into
the VectorMAP (mission planner) for setting up sonar tracks.
This option can be combined with a DVL for improved positional accuracy. The multibeam
sonar is provided as a 12" wet section to the EP30 vehicle and the ideal
solution for a variety of survey requirements.

Example Multibeam Mission in a Shallow Bay
Mission Plan Highlights:
Two Iver2 Commercial AUVs configured with Imagenex 837B Delta T
Multibeam and
10 beam DVLs for added positional accuracy
VectorMap mission plan includes 5 separate sweeps done at 2 knots
3-4 hours runtime for each sweep utilizing less than half the
battery capacity
